🔍 Installation & Renter-Friendly Setup

All three cameras avoid drilling entirely. Blink sits naturally on any flat surface and can go near a window or small covered space with its weather-resistant adapter. Arlo runs wire-free with a rechargeable battery, giving you total placement freedom — especially on balconies. Wyze’s plug-in setup is quick, and its 360° motion makes it perfect for monitoring larger rooms without adding extra devices.

Setup takes only a few minutes in each app, even for first-time smart home users.

🔍 Video Quality & Low-Light Clarity

Clear footage matters when you’re checking alerts or reviewing motion clips.

  • Blink Mini 2 offers crisp 1080p HD that’s reliable indoors
  • Arlo Essential 2K delivers the strongest detail, especially at night
  • Wyze Cam Pan v3 uses 1080p but makes up for it with full-room coverage

If night performance matters most, Arlo leads the group with its color night vision.

🔍 Motion Alerts & App Features

These cameras excel at real-time awareness.

  • Blink sends straightforward motion clips with simple controls
  • Arlo provides richer notifications and customizable activity zones
  • Wyze lets you pan/tilt the camera in real time, a huge advantage for monitoring pets or wide living spaces

All three apps are intuitive, making it easy to check your home anytime.

🔍 Power Options & Placement Flexibility

How you power the camera shapes where you can place it.

  • Blink Mini 2 uses plug-in power for steady indoor coverage
  • Arlo Essential is completely wireless, ideal for balconies or rentals with limited outlets
  • Wyze Pan v3 plugs in but covers more angles than any static camera

If you prefer fewer cables or want exterior visibility, Arlo is the top pick.

📦 Blink Mini 2 + Weather Resistant Adapter — Best Indoor Choice

Blink Mini 2 is perfect for renters who want a neat indoor setup with the flexibility to monitor patios or window areas. It’s compact, simple to reposition, and delivers reliable HD footage with minimal fuss.

📦 Arlo Essential Security Camera 2K — Best Wireless Balcony Option

Arlo Essential stands out for renters who want outdoor-friendly visibility without touching the building. The magnetic mount and rechargeable battery make it truly no-drill, and its 2K clarity provides excellent detail day or night.

📦 Wyze Cam Pan v3 — Best Budget 360° Coverage

Wyze Pan v3 gives you huge room coverage without adding more cameras. Its pan/tilt features work well for open layouts, and its budget price makes it the most cost-effective way to monitor multiple angles.
